[0003] Traditional cotton fiber dyeing adopts high-temperature scouring treatment. Generally, soda ash or scouring agent is added to boil the cotton. The temperature is high and the energy consumption is high. After scouring, the corner water must be released, otherwise the dyeing rate will be reduced. Increase the amount of dye
At the same time, cold water washing should be carried out, and the temperature should be lowered to below 60 degrees, otherwise it will be easy to stain, so the water consumption is relatively high, so the energy consumption of various items is relatively high. In order to further reduce energy consumption, it is urgent to improve the process

Embodiment 1

[0024] A kind of cotton dyeing process comprises the following steps:

[0025] (1) Pretreatment: Add the compound of sodium alkylsulfonate and alkyl polyethylene glycol ether in water at 55-70 degrees Celsius, then add cotton to water and boil for 20-30 minutes, take it out and wash it with water for 10 minutes;

[0026] (2) Dyeing treatment: add the cotton treated in step (1) into the dyeing vat at room temperature, then add dye, soak for 10 minutes, then add sodium sulfate three times, each time at an interval of 3-10 minutes; then add caustic soda into the dyeing vat After adding caustic soda, the water temperature is raised to 60°C, and the heating rate is 1°C per minute;

[0027] (3) Post-processing: add the dyed cotton in step (2) into boiling water and boil for 10 minutes, then add soaping agent and boil for 10 minutes, and then wash with water 2-3 times; the above soaping agent is non-foaming soaping agent , is a modified maleic acid-acrylic acid polymer.

Abstract

The present invention relates to the technical field of dyeing processes in textile industry, more particularly to a cotton dyeing process, which comprises: (1) placing cotton into a dyeing jar, adding normal temperature water into the dyeing jar while adding a whitening agent, and soaking for 10-20 min; (2) sequentially adding caustic soda, a hydrogen peroxide stabilizer and a penetrant to the dyeing jar; (3) adding hydrogen peroxide, increasing the water temperature to 95-98 DEG C at a speed of 1 DEG C / 1 min, and carrying out thermal insulation for 30 min; and (4) taking out the cotton, neutralizing with an acid liquid, and washing with deionized water until the ph value is 6-8. According to the present invention, the bleaching process and the whitening process are integrated into the one-step operation, such that the water consumption is saved, the electricity for heating is saved, the working time is saved, the working efficiency is improved, the bleaching effect and the whitening effect are substantially improved, and the treatment at the late stage is conveniently performed.
